4 Common Interior Painting Myths Debunked

When it comes to interior painting, there are a myriad of conflicting tips and tricks that can make even the simplest of interior painting projects seem challenging. In order to achieve the best commercial or residential interior painting outcome, it is important to know which tips are fact and which are fiction. Check out these four common interior painting myths you should stop believing today!

professionally completed interior painting project

1. Using Multiple Coats of Paint Means You Don't Need Primer

In most cases, using a primer is essential and is useful for many reasons. Not only will using a primer help the paint properly adhere to the wall, it will also give your walls a more professional look, contributing to the overall desired outcome. Therefore, it is important not to skip primer for the vast majority of interior painting projects.

2. You Do Not Need to Clean the Walls if You Use Primer

Using a primer prepares the surface for the paint. However, using a primer does not eliminate the need to clean your walls. To ensure the primer adheres properly and your walls are fully prepped for a quality paint job, it is important to clean your walls, removing any dust, dirt, grease, or other stains.

3. It Doesn't Matter Which Brand/Type of Paint You Use

Not all paints are created equal. Different types of surfaces and even specific rooms require different types of paint and paint finishes. In addition, investing in higher quality paint will produce lasting results, saving you from having to frequently repaint and spend even more money.
